What's your opinion on George Washington University?

Can anyone give me an honest assessment of George Washington University? Like, what are your overall thoughts on the university's environment, academics, and social life? I'm considering applying next year and need some insider info!

As someone familiar with George Washington University (GWU), I can offer some perspective. Keep in mind that experiences may vary and this is just one assessment of the university.

GWU is located in the heart of Washington, D.C., which provides numerous academic and professional opportunities. Being in the nation's capital allows students interested in politics, international affairs, or public health to access internships, events, and resources that other universities may not have. Their Elliott School of International Affairs and Milken Institute School of Public Health are particularly highly regarded.

In terms of academics, GWU has a diverse array of programs and courses taught by qualified faculty. Class sizes, especially in higher-level courses, tend to be smaller, which facilitates better engagement and personalized support. The overall academic environment can be competitive, but it also fosters intellectual growth and collaboration.

Regarding the social life, GWU is home to a variety of student clubs and organizations covering various interests such as arts, sports, and community service. The student body is quite diverse and students are generally engaged politically and socially. When it comes to Greek life, it does exist, but it's not as prevalent compared to some other universities, hence the social scene is not exclusively centered around Greek events.

The campus itself is urban, with some buildings scattered around the Foggy Bottom neighborhood. This can be a pro or a con depending on your preference for a college environment. Some students love being in the midst of a bustling city, while others might yearn for a more traditional, enclosed college campus. Keep in mind that D.C. can be quite expensive when budgeting for housing, meals, and entertainment.

Overall, George Washington University offers an immersive urban experience full of academic and professional opportunities in a politically and socially active environment. However, it's essential to consider your own personal preferences and priorities when deciding if GWU might be the right fit for you.
